A recreation centre in Onchan for families on the Isle of Man will close its doors just after Christmas.
After 15 years in business, The Dance & Fun Factory, which also houses Jump Zone IOM, will shut due to 'family commitments and other things.'
The owners are thanking staff, customers 'and especially the children' for the years of continued support.
They're also looking to resell all structures as a package or separately and are urging anyone interested to contact them.
